An exciting opportunity has arisen to deliver education and training within the School of Pharmacy at the University of Huddersfield. We are a successful department offering excellent teaching and research facilities and are seeking to appoint an experienced pharmacy practitioner with a record of supporting education, training and professional development of the healthcare workforce to join the Pharmacy Department in the University of Huddersfield.
You must be a UK registered pharmacist and the post would suit both an experienced academic clinical practitioner (Senior Practitioner) or pharmacists wanting to start an academic career while maintaining their clinical practice (Practitioner). If you would like to use your skills and experience to make a real difference to the future of the profession, we look forward to hearing from you.
You will be responsible organising and delivering teaching and simulation for students on programmes for pharmacists and pharmacy technicians and require the clinical experience to inform and inspire trainees to become excellent practitioners. They will contribute to the design and delivery of learning and teaching materials (including examinations). The post holder will co-ordinate and support the development of modules in degree programmes whilst liaising with Programme and Year tutors and those in other Subject Groups.

As a Practitioner, we expect you to be actively engaged in practice in addition to your role at the University. This can be either through paid employment with another employer, paid consultancy or freelance work.
